    Its like this... (and ORD should know this by now) we find you a load that delivers near your home. You deliver the load, drop the trailer where instructed to (usually some place that will load it for another driver,) and bobtail home. If you can't park the tractor near your house, you'll need to make an arrangement to deal with it... a suitable and friendly business, a truckstop, etc.

    On the way out you just reverse it... grab the tractor, pickup an empty where your FM tells you to find one and go get a load...
